Car tax and more big changes that will hit motorists this year – starting on April 1

· March 8, 2021 ·

The Chancellor may have frozen fuel duty for the tenth year running, but drivers face a raft of new changes from April, when the new tax year comes into force. Road tax is rising in line with inflation while local clean air zone charges - which currently only exist in the capital - are set to be rolled out across major UK cities as the crackdown against pollution continues. Elsewhere, proposals are being tabled for a Greater London charge, which would cost drivers £3.50 a day to enter the outer boroughs. "While tax increases and changes in tax law are inevitable and even necessary, if not always welcome," Keith Hawes at Nationwide Vehicle Contracts , said. "It's already been a difficult year for Britain’s motorists, and proposed tax changes are unlikely to make it any easier." Increasing Vehicle Excise Duty (VED) VED, often called road tax, is rising in the new tax year which means you'll have to pay more to keep driving your car. German court rules Audi not liable in VW emissions scandal — for now

· January 8, 2021 ·

On Monday, Germany's Federal Court of Justice ruled that the auto manufacturer Audi is not immediately liable to pay compensation for its parent company's role in rigging diesel emissions. Liability could shift to the Volkswagen subsidiary if it can be shown that bosses there knew that unauthorized technology had been installed in vehicles when they put them on the market. Judges had indicated that it would be difficult to prove Audi's liability, as a subsidiary of Volkswagen, in installing the so-called defeat devices from the parent company. What does the court's decision mean? Tens of thousands of vehicle owners in Germany are entitled to damages after a 2020 landmark court ruling on the Volkswagen diesel scandal. However, it was unclear whether the liability could also be applied to Volkswagen's subsidiary Audi. Germany: First CEO faces trial over ‘dieselgate’ scandal

· January 30, 2020 ·

Former-Audi CEO Rupert Stadler on Wednesday became the first top executive to stand trial in Germany for his role in an enormous emissions-cheating scandal. Stadler, 57, appeared before the Munich district court to answer charges of fraud, falsifying certifications and false advertising. Former Audi and Porsche manager Wolfgang Hatz and two Audi engineers are being tried alongside Stadler, facing charges of fraud. German car giant Volkswagen — whose subsidiaries include Porsche, Audi, Skoda and Seat — admitted in September 2015 that it had installed software to rig emissions in 11 million diesel vehicles worldwide. Criminal proceedings have taken place in the United States over the scandal, leading to the imprisonment of two Volkswagen employees. In Germany, there have been no convictions over the scam. Prosecutors opened the proceedings on Wednesday by reading aloud an over 90-page indictment. The trial is expected to last more than two years.
